The Making of Scott Sigler

Born in Cheboygan, Michigan, Scott Carl Sigler grew up with a love for monster flicks, thanks to his father, and a passion for reading, nurtured by his schoolteacher mother. At eight, he penned his first story, 'Tentacles, Tentacles & More Tentacles,' hinting at the creepy creativity to come. After earning degrees in journalism and marketing from Olivet College and Cleary College, Sigler’s career path was anything but linear—think fast food, fruit picking, and even shoveling horse manure! But his knack for storytelling led him to journalism, marketing, and eventually, writing full-time.

In 2005, Sigler made a bold move: he released his novel 'Earthcore' as the world’s first podcast-only novel, a gamble that paid off with over 10,000 subscribers. This pioneering spirit set the stage for his rise as a podcaster and author, proving he was unafraid to break the mold.

Scott Sigler’s Unforgettable Stories

Sigler’s bibliography is a treasure trove of science fiction and horror, with 20 novels, seven novellas, and countless short stories. His 'Infected' trilogy—'Infected,' 'Contagious,' and 'Pandemic'—is a masterclass in blending hard science with visceral terror. The series follows a mysterious pathogen turning ordinary people into raging killers, weaving suspense with an alien agenda. Fans and critics alike praise its relentless pace and chilling realism, with James Rollins calling it 'a marvel of gonzo, in-your-face terror.'

Beyond 'Infected,' Sigler’s 'Galactic Football League' series, starting with 'The Rookie,' mixes sci-fi sports drama with gritty crime, like 'Star Wars' meets 'The Godfather.' His young adult 'Generations' trilogy, beginning with 'Alive,' explores identity and survival through a teen heroine waking in a coffin. Sigler’s style—often compared to Stephen King and Chuck Palahniuk—leans on vivid characters, scientific intrigue, and a knack for keeping readers on edge.

His podcast 'Scott Sigler Slices,' the longest-running fiction podcast since 2005, delivers weekly doses of horror and sci-fi, including exclusive series like 'Slay.' With over 50 million downloads, Sigler’s audio storytelling keeps his 'Junkies' hooked, blending dark humor and gruesome twists.

Why Scott Sigler Matters

Sigler’s impact goes beyond his page-turners. By embracing podcasting early, he democratized storytelling, offering free content that built a global fanbase. His 'Junkies' have downloaded over 50 million episodes, a testament to his ability to connect directly with readers. As an inaugural inductee into the Podcasting Hall of Fame in 2015, Sigler’s innovation has inspired countless authors to explore new media.

His work also resonates culturally, tackling themes like human survival, identity, and the ethics of science. Whether it’s the apocalyptic stakes of 'Pandemic' or the coming-of-age grit in 'Alive,' Sigler’s stories challenge readers to confront the unknown. His co-founding of Empty Set Entertainment further cements his legacy, nurturing his 'Galactic Football League' series and beyond.

About Scott Sigler

  • Born: Cheboygan, Michigan
  • Key Works: 'Infected' trilogy, 'Galactic Football League' series, 'Alive'
  • Awards: Podcasting Hall of Fame (2015), Parsec Awards (2008–2011)
  • Fun Fact: A die-hard Detroit Lions fan, Sigler lives in San Diego with his dog, Reesie.
